When I was first starting out in D&D, my DM used the crit and fumble tables from MERP. These are just the best and I highly recommend using them in your game it at all possible.
If you roll a 1 or 20, you then roll percentile dice, and cross-reference it with the type of weapon you are using. (And modified at the bottom of the pages by what kind of what type of weapon you are using...hey, it's MERP.)
The turtle lives at the bottom right, hand arms fumble table, 97-99. I can not TELL you the number of times that turtle took a competent fighter and turned him into a world-class ballet dancer for 3 rounds. =3

WEAPON SPECIALIZATION (EX) 3rd Level
You gain the Weapon Specialization feat as a bonus feat for
each weapon type this class grants you proficiency with.
Weapon Specialization (Combat): Choose one weapon type (small arms, longarms, heavy weapons, etc.). You gain specialization in that weapon type, which means you add your character level to damage with the selected weapon type, or half your character level for small arms or operative melee weapons. You can never have specialization in grenades.
